Ingredients for Amla Juice

When it comes to making Amla juice at home, the key lies in using the right ingredients to maximize its health benefits. Amla, also known as Indian gooseberry, is a powerhouse of nutrients and antioxidants. By incorporating specific ingredients into the recipe, you can enhance the nutrition and overall value of the Amla juice.

Fresh Amla or Amla Powder

The primary ingredient for Amla juice is, of course, Amla itself. You can use fresh Amla fruits or Amla powder to make the juice. Fresh Amla is preferred for its higher vitamin C content and natural freshness. On the other hand, if fresh Amla is not available, high-quality Amla powder can be a suitable alternative.

Water

Water serves as the base for diluting the Amla juice concentrate or blending in fresh Amla. It is important to use filtered or purified water to maintain the purity of the juice.

Sweetener (Optional)

Depending on personal preference, a sweetener such as honey, jaggery, or sugar can be added to counteract the tartness of Amla. However, for those looking to minimize sugar intake, it’s recommended to consume unsweetened Amla juice.

Ginger (Optional)

Adding a few slices of ginger to the Amla juice can provide extra flavor and potential health benefits. Ginger is known for its digestive properties and can complement the tanginess of Amla quite well.

Mint Leaves (Optional)

For a refreshing twist, mint leaves can be included in the recipe. Not only does it enhance the aroma and taste of the juice, but it also contributes additional nutrients such as vitamins and minerals.

Amla Juice Preparation

Amla juice, also known as Indian gooseberry juice, is a popular health drink due to its numerous benefits. It is rich in vitamin C and antioxidants, making it an excellent addition to your daily diet. Making amla juice at home is simple, and it allows you to enjoy all the natural goodness of this nutritious fruit without any added preservatives or artificial flavors.

To make amla juice at home, you will need fresh amla (Indian gooseberries), water, honey or sugar (optional), and a pinch of salt. Start by washing the amla thoroughly to remove any dirt or impurities. Then, chop the amla into small pieces and remove the seeds. It’s important to deseed the amla as the seeds can be bitter and affect the taste of the juice.

Next, place the chopped amla pieces in a blender or juicer along with some water. Blend it well until you get a smooth puree. You can adjust the consistency of the puree by adding more or less water according to your preference.

Once blended, strain the puree using a fine mesh strainer or cheesecloth to extract the juice while removing any pulp or residue. Add honey or sugar to sweeten the juice if desired, along with a pinch of salt to enhance the flavor.

Amla juice can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2-3 days. It is recommended to consume fresh amla juice as it may lose some of its nutritional value over time.

Here are some tips and tricks for best results when preparing Amla Juice:

  • Choose ripe and fresh amla for maximum nutrition
  • Use cold water while blending or juicing to retain nutrients
  • Adjust sweetness and salt according to personal taste preferences
  • Store in glass containers for better preservation

Alternative Amla Juice Recipes

Amla, also known as Indian gooseberry, is renowned for its numerous health benefits and high nutritional value. This superfruit is packed with vitamin C, antioxidants, and other essential nutrients that contribute to overall well-being. Amla is often consumed in the form of juice due to its potent properties and easy assimilation into the body.

Amla juice is a versatile beverage that can be customized to suit individual tastes and preferences. While the traditional Amla juice recipe involves simply extracting the juice from fresh Amla fruits, there are various alternative recipes that offer unique flavors and added health benefits.

Here are some alternative Amla juice recipes to consider:

1. Amla Mint Cooler:

Simply blend the Amla fruits, mint leaves, and sweetener with water until smooth. Strain the mixture to remove any pulp, and enjoy this refreshing and digestive-friendly beverage.

2. Amla Pineapple Delight:

Extract the juice from Amla fruits and blend it with chopped pineapple pieces. Add a hint of ginger juice for an extra kick of flavor. This tropical twist on Amla juice is rich in vitamin C and enzymes.

3. Mixed Berry Amla Crush:

Combine freshly extracted Amla juice with a mix of your favorite berries and a splash of lemon juice for a tangy burst of antioxidants and fruity goodness.

Serving Amla Juice

Amla juice, also known as Indian gooseberry juice, is a rich source of essential nutrients and antioxidants that offer numerous health benefits. Consuming amla juice regularly can contribute to overall well-being and vitality. If you’re wondering about the best ways to consume amla juice and the ideal time to drink it, here are some suggestions to help you incorporate this nutritious beverage into your daily routine.

Ways to Consume Amla Juice:

  • Plain Amla Juice: The simplest way to consume amla juice is by drinking it as is, without any additives or flavorings. This allows you to experience the pure taste and benefits of amla.
  • Amla Juice Blend: You can mix amla juice with other fruit juices, such as orange juice or grape juice, to create a flavorful blend that is enjoyable for those who may find the taste of plain amla juice too strong.
  • Amla Juice Smoothie: Incorporate amla juice into homemade smoothies by blending it with yogurt, bananas, or other fruits for added texture and flavor.
  • Amla Juice Shots: For a quick and concentrated dose of nutrients, consider taking small shots of amla juice in the morning on an empty stomach.

The Best Time to Drink Amla Juice:

  1. Empty Stomach in the Morning: Drinking a glass of fresh amla juice on an empty stomach in the morning can help kickstart your metabolism and provide an instant boost of energy for the day ahead.
  2. Before Meals: Consuming a small portion of amla juice before meals can aid digestion and enhance nutrient absorption from the food you eat.
  3. Post-Workout: Replenish your body’s nutrients after exercise by consuming a refreshing glass of chilled amla juice to rehydrate and rejuvenate your system.
